Revolutionary Shaft Seal Technology
At the heart of the NK range is a robust Silicon Carbide/Silicon Carbide (SiC/SiC) hard-faced seal. This new design offers:
Extended Temperature Range: Handles liquids from -13°F to +248°F, with options reaching up to 284°F.
Abrasive Resistance: Engineered to handle grit and abrasives better than standard mechanical seals.
Alignment Integrity: The bearing bracket is produced in a single manufacturing process to eliminate misalignment, a common cause of seal failure.
Flexible Installation & Serviceability
Whether your facility requires a standard foundation or a specialized non-grouting setup, the NK series adapts to your infrastructure.
Back Pull-Out Design: This allows for the removal of the motor and impeller without disturbing the pump housing or the connected pipework.
Self-Venting Volute: The top centerline discharge design allows for natural self-venting and enables more compact piping layouts.
Sturdy Base Frame: The heavy-duty design ensures the pump and motor stay perfectly aligned over years of continuous operation.
Optional Spacer Coupling: Simplifies maintenance by allowing access to the mechanical seal and impeller without moving the motor.

NK vs. NKE: Choosing Your Performance Tier
Grundfos NK: The "Workhorse." Ideal for fixed-speed applications in HVAC, district energy, and water utilities where rugged reliability is the primary requirement.
Grundfos NKE: The "Intelligent Powerhouse." Featuring an integrated frequency converter and high-efficiency MGE motor, the NKE series automatically adjusts to real-time system demands for maximum energy savings.
